Job Title

Consumer Loan Specialist

FLSA Status

Non-Exempt

About the Role

Build meaningful relationships with both existing and potential members, guiding them through the loan experience from first conversation to final decision. Focus on understanding each member’s needs and offering loan solutions that support their financial well‑being. Own the pipeline to ensure a smooth, timely, and transparent experience for every member. This role is performance‑based, rewarding results with competitive base pay and uncapped commission.

What

You Will Do
  • Guide members through the consumer lending process, from application intake and needs assessment to identifying appropriate cross‑sell opportunities and communicating loan decisions for auto, boat, RV, personal loans, and credit cards.
  • Engage with members in a responsive and caring way, following up on inquiries and applications with urgency. Drive loan growth and member engagement through strategic outbound calling with existing members.
  • Manage a pipeline of loan applications with accuracy, timeliness, and follow‑through.
  • Review consumer credit information to make sound lending decisions and identify opportunities that align with members’ financial goals.
  • Achieve individual loan production and ancillary product goals while contributing to overall team success.
  • Submit complete and accurate loan applications and gather required documentation to ensure efficient and compliant processing.
  • Work closely with processing teams and branch partners to provide a smooth, well‑coordinated loan closing experience.
  • Clearly explain lending requirements, decisions, and next steps so members feel informed and confident throughout the process.
  • Address questions or concerns promptly to maintain a high level of member service.
  • Stay informed on lending regulations, internal policies, and fraud‑prevention practices.
  • Demonstrate flexibility in a changing environment and contribute positively to a collaborative, high‑performing team.
  • Model Seattle Credit Union’s values in every member and colleague interaction.
  • Demonstrate excellent written, verbal, and interpersonal communication skills.
  • Demonstrate excellent customer service skills to both internal and external audiences.
  • Demonstrate commitment to SCU Values.
  • Establish and maintain collaborative relationships with all levels of teammates across the organization.
  • Maintain regular and punctual attendance.
  • Remain vigilant in identifying and preventing potential fraud throughout the application and loan funding process.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
Basic Qualifications
  • High School Diploma or GED.
  • Experience working in a financial institution.
  • Knowledge of lending systems and origination processes.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io).
  • Sales experience preferred in any setting where you’ve influenced, persuaded, or guided others toward a decision.
Preferred Qualifications
  • 3+ years of experience in a financial institution.
  • 1+ year of experience originating and/or processing consumer loan applications.
  • Written and verbal fluency in Spanish.
  • Strong understanding of consumer lending products.
  • Experience with titled collateral and related loan processes.
Working Conditions
  • This is a hybrid role with work performed both remotely and in an office and/or branch environment in the Greater Seattle area of Washington State.
  • Staff may be required to attend special off‑hour meetings and/or seminars.
  • The nature of the work involves prolonged sitting and computer use.
  • Availability to work weekend and holiday hours on a rotating basis.
Compensation and Benefits

Employees receive low‑cost medical contributions, zero contributions for dental and vision plans, generous paid time off, and a 401(k) plan with a dollar‑for‑dollar employer match up to 5%.
